Allegro; E-flat major, 3/8 time. Three-note measures pair an accented opening note with a two-note slur. Rising and falling broken chords recur at different pitch levels, with chromatic alterations in the middle and a dotted-quarter E-flat at the end.
Measures 1–12: The opening figure is E♭4–B♭3–G3. The written pitches span G3 to B♭5. Measure 12 ends on E♭5.
Measures 13–24: The opening figure is D5–G5–F5. The written pitches span G3 to G5. Measure 24 ends on E♭4.
Measures 25–36: The opening figure is C4–E♭4–C4. The written pitches span B♭3 to B♭5. Measure 36 ends on E♭4.
Measures 37–48: The opening figure is F4–B♭4–D5. The written pitches span F4 to B♭5. Measure 48 ends on B♭4.
Measures 49–60: The opening figure is A♭4–G4–F4. The written pitches span F4 to B♭5. Measure 60 ends on F4.
Measures 61–72: The opening figure is E♭4–D4–C4. The written pitches span G3 to G5. Measure 72 ends on D5.
Measures 73–81: The opening figure is C5–A♭4–E♭4. The written pitches span C4 to B♭5. The study closes on E♭4.
